The Book of Days: A Miscellany of Popular Antiquities in Connection With the Calendar V4 is a comprehensive reference book written by Robert Chambers. It is a collection of fascinating historical and cultural facts and traditions associated with each day of the year. The book is divided into 12 chapters, each corresponding to a month of the year, and covers a wide range of topics, including folklore, superstitions, customs, and celebrations. The fourth volume of the series covers the months of October, November, and December. Volume 4 of 4: Including Anecdote, Biography and History, Curiosities of Literature and Oddities of Human Life and Character. The Book of Days consists of: Matters connected with the Church Calendar, including the popular festivals, Saints' Days, and other holidays with illustrations of Christian antiquities in general; Phenomena connected with the seasonal changes; Folklore of the United Kingdom, namely popular notions and observances connected with times and seasons; Notable events, biographies, and anecdotes connected with the days of the year and; Articles of popular archaeology, of an entertaining character, tending to illustrate the progress of civilization, manners, literature, and ideas in these kingdoms. These volumes depict a day by day account of what has occurred in ancient times, including and proceeding the Middle Ages. Volume 4 covers October through December. Illustrations.
